Engine & Transmission

The Concerto is a compact car with a 1.6L inline-four engine producing 122 horsepower and 140 Nm of torque. It features a front-wheel drive layout and a 5-speed manual transmission. The engine is naturally aspirated and features DOHC and multi-port manifold injection. The suspension is coil spring-based for both the front and rear wheels.

Brakes

The Concerto model features ventilated discs for front brakes and drum brakes for the rear. It comes equipped with an Anti-lock braking system (ABS) for enhanced safety. The steering system consists of a rack and pinion type with hydraulic power steering for smooth handling. The tires are sized at 175/70 R13.

Weight & Capacity

The Concerto is a well-balanced car with a good weight-to-power ratio of 8.9 kg/Hp and a weight-to-torque ratio of 7.7 kg/Nm. It has a kerb weight of 1080 kg and a maximum weight of 1580 kg, with a maximum load capacity of 500 kg. The car has a spacious trunk with a minimum boot space of 420 liters and a fuel tank capacity of 55 liters.
